On March 11, 1968, KFWB ended its Top 40 era, and was relaunched as an all-news radio station. KFWB (980 AM) is a commercial radio station in Los Angeles, California.It airs a classic Regional Mexican music format.KFWB is owned by Lotus Communications.The station has a colorful history, being the radio voice of Warner Bros. Studios in the early days of broadcasting, and a long-time Group W/CBS radio station from 1966 to 2016. Costello near the 5/10-freeway interchange, which is shared with KLAC-570.). radio dial.
